Output ebc401091af070a78d6bc7882a87428a24bd72691577fff77906c7d4f727a6f8:1

value
3213966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b882cc731c0137bfbd59d1da873279362247ddf17be2310bcad220f2d6adef7f
address
bc1phzpvcucuqymml02e68dgwvnexc3y0h03003rzz726gs0944daalspm42lw
transaction
ebc401091af070a78d6bc7882a87428a24bd72691577fff77906c7d4f727a6f8
spent
true